tl;dr: A seller telegraphed a potential buyer, “I am asking 23 cents per pound” for seed. The buyer replied, “We accept your offer.” The court held that the seller’s statement was merely an invitation to negotiate, not a binding offer, so no contract was formed.

Legal Significance: This case establishes that a mere price quotation or a statement of a price one is “asking” is generally not a binding offer, but rather an invitation to negotiate, especially when the context suggests ongoing bargaining.

Case Facts & Court Holding

Key Facts & Case Background

Defendant, Abraham, was a seller of clover seed. After some preliminary communications, Plaintiff, Courteen Seed Co., telegraphed Defendant requesting a “firm offer, naming absolutely lowest f. o. b.” In response, Defendant sent a telegram stating: “I am asking 23 cents per pound for the car of red clover seed from which your sample was taken. No. 1 seed, practically no plantain whatever. Have an offer 22-% per pound, f. o. b. Amity.” Plaintiff immediately replied by wire: “Telegram received. We accept your offer. Ship promptly…” Defendant refused to deliver the seed, asserting no contract had been formed. Plaintiff sued for breach of contract. The trial court denied Defendant’s motion for a nonsuit, and Defendant appealed.

Court Holding & Legal Precedent

Issue: Does a telegram stating “I am asking” a certain price for goods, sent in response to a request for a “firm offer,” constitute a legally binding offer that can be accepted to form a contract?
